Flushing salon owner Julien Farel caters to U.S. Open stars looking for a haircut


For seven years, Queens salon owner Julien Farel has styled the stars.

Farel, whose salon is located in Flushing near the USTA Billie Jean King National Tennis Center, has a special contract with the U.S. Open and caters to some of the game's biggest talents. He has styled the likes of Rafael Nadal, Novak Djokovic and Victoria Azarenka.

He says he usually sees around 50 people each day.

"It's a great treat ... it's an honor," says Farel.

The owner says many of his customers don't ask for full treatment, only a trim ahead of their matches.

Farel says every player who visits the salon signs a giant tennis ball that is later donated to charity.
